Red Bus Hi! We are a custom body and collision shop called Metal Mayhem in Snowflake, AZ. We wanted to show you one of the builds we did on a customers 1965 VW Bus. The customer came in wanting to have the body work fixed, complete interior and exterior paint as well as, replace the rubbers & moldings, sunroof repair, install bumpers, R&R wheels & tires,window tint, and to detail the van in full. After a few months of work, and some loving time the bus, we were able to complete the final look of the bus. This is such a blatant advertisement, which I thought was not permitted. Don't move it to the Bay Window forum - just remove it.

Also, if the restorer thinks this is a '65 bus, he obviously has no idea what he is doing, or what he is doing it to.

It's also not a restoration, as in bring it back to original. It is a customization, meaning that it is made into something new that the customer apparently wanted. No bus like this was ever made by VW.
